MANAMA, Bahrain (July 1, 2024) Participants from the Multinational Combat Casualty Care Engagement conference, exchange techniques and best practices during a lifesaving medical treatment training, July 1. The goal of the conference was to strengthen relationships among senior medical leaders across various countries and enhance medical capabilities in the U.S. Fifth Fleet region.

250226-N-FF029-1001 MANAMA, Bahrain (Feb. 26, 2025) International Maritime Exercise (IMX) 2025 highlight video in Manama, Bahrain. IMX25 is the largest multinational training event in the Middle East, involving 5,000 personnel from around 30 nations and international organizations committed to preserving the rules-based international order and strengthening regional maritime security cooperation.
